Find the value of log(4) ∙ log(25) to five decimal places.

Answer:0.84164

Explanation:

Given


\log \left ( 4\right )\cdot \log \left ( 25\right )

we know


\log a^b=b\log a

Applying this identity we get


\log \left ( 2\right )^2\cdot \log \left ( 5\right )^2


=2\log \left ( 2\right )* 2\log \left ( 5\right )


=4* \log \left ( 2\right )\cdot \left ( 5\right )


=4* 0.301029* 0.698970


=0.84164
